So, just a few hours ago the 2012 Book Bloggers and Publishers Online Conference ended, and I miss it already. The BBPOC was a 5 day long series of discussion about blogging and the publishing industry, and I learned so so much.

The host Terry Kate of Romance in the Back Seat, was fantastic and covered a lot of topics I was genuinely interested in. Time Management, Negative Reviews and way more topics that are really relevant in today’s blogosphere. There are still quite a few panels I need to catch up on but ahhhhh, it was all so good!

For me, the other highlight was the live discussion that went on in the chat room throughout the entire conference. I met so many other fantastic bloggers who I really respect. I really love this community. I may have even found some roommates for BEA, and I’m pretty excited about that too.
